>> > >> Hi Justin,
>> > >>
>> > >> In some final testing of the Java broker we came across an issue we
>> feel
>> > >> warrants blocker status, and so would like to request another RC be
>> cut
>> > on
>> > >> Monday before calling the vote in order to allow including the fix in
>> > the
>> > >> release.
>> > >>
>> > >> http://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/QPID-4858
>> > >> http://svn.apache.org/r1483866
>> > >>
>> > >> There are more specifics on the JIRA, but the short story is that
>> due to
>> > >> changes made in this development cycle it became possible to
>> configure
>> > the
>> > >> brokers HTTP management port(s) in an ambiguous way that suggested
>> SSL
>> > was
>> > >> in use on the port when it was not, a situation we would obviously
>> like
>> > to
>> > >> prevent for reasons.
>> > >>
>> > >> The change is fairly simple and involves removal of some
>> inconsistency
>> > in
>> > >> configuration between the HTTP and non-HTTP ports, removing the
>> > ambiguity
>> > >> that lead to the issue. Aside from the obvious security-related
>> benefit,
>> > >> making the change in this release would also be beneficial to avoid a
>> > need
>> > >> for explicit handling of the configuration change during upgrades to
>> > future
>> > >> releases.
